Output 70655ba4e8804356cdf01d9992431527648ad61f80512a06543f34ab57ba9d15:0

value
12793776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38f9aac43e1c0de1199f434783130025abf1248b OP_EQUAL
address
MD6RALuDA7ZDg2sJVinWm9mGJevf4p8ta4
transaction
70655ba4e8804356cdf01d9992431527648ad61f80512a06543f34ab57ba9d15
spent
true